www.thegreatsilkroad.com Over the last years alongside with ecotourism, Silk Road tourism, mountaineering and trekking Kyrgyzstan has been developing pilgrimage tourism.
Popular places of pilgrimage include the famous Suleiman -Mount in Osh, memorial complex in Safed-Bulan village, "Padisha-Ota" mausoleum, and "Manjyly-Ata" complex well-known far beyond Kyrgyzstan.
The Ton valley used to be a burial area for nomadic tribes of the Saki and Usuni. One can meet here many stones with petroglyphs, medieval tombs, the ruins of ancient settlements as well as centuries-old tumuli. On the territory between Bokonbayevo and Tosor villages there is a holy place, where according to the popular legends there was buried the great soothsayer.
Many pilgrims from Kyrgyzstan as well as from neighbouring countries come to worship this place. The local citizens do much in order to develop this area. Thus there was built the mausoleum of the old wise man Manjyly-Ata whose spirit is said to create many good things.
A special lodging for pilgrims, a kitchen where the funeral repast can be prepared, and a site for praying were built here too. The complex is surrounded by 13 springs which are believed to bring health and to fulfill the wishes. The water in each of these springs has different taste and healing power. |
